US President Donald Trump said that Kremlin leader Vladimir Putin has "gone absolutely crazy." He added that if he decides to take over all of Ukraine, then Russia will be in for a disaster. About this posted the head of the White House on the social network Truth Social.
Trump's statements came after Russia has been massively shelling Ukraine with drones and missiles for several days in a row.
"I've always had a very good relationship with Vladimir Putin of Russia, but something has happened to him. He's gone absolutely crazy! He's killing a lot of people unnecessarily, and I'm not just talking about soldiers. He's launching missiles and drones at cities in Ukraine for no reason. I've always said he wants ALL of Ukraine, not just part of it, and maybe that will turn out to be true, but if he does that, it will lead to the collapse of Russia." he wrote
In addition to criticizing Putin, Trump criticized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ky, in particular, because his words allegedly create problems.
"In the same way, President Zelensky is not doing his country any good by speaking the way he does. Everything that comes out of his mouth creates problems, I don't like it, and it would be better if it stopped," the US president emphasized.
He also reiterated that the war in Ukraine would never have started if he had been president. In addition, Trump distanced himself from the Russia-Ukraine war, stating that it was not his war.
"This is Zelensky, Putin, and Biden's war, not Trump's. I'm just helping put out the big and ugly fires that have been started by gross incompetence and hatred," — the American leader summed up.
